Abstract

The invention discloses a pulsating high gradient superconducting magnetic separation machine, and relates to production equipment for separation on the basis of material magnetic difference. The pulsating high gradient superconducting magnetic separation machine comprises a supporting mechanism, the supporting mechanism supports separation mechanisms to do reciprocating motion at solenoid superconducting magnet center along the solenoid superconducting magnet axis, each separation mechanism comprises a plurality of medium boxes, each medium box is provided with a high gradient medium, the center of the medium box is provided with a through hole along the axis of the medium box, one side of the medium box is provided with a supporting plate, the other side of the medium box is provided with a tympanic membrane piece, a tympanic membrane piece connection shaft passes through the medium box, the supporting plate and a center through hole arranged along the axis of the tympanic membrane piece, and is fixedly connected with the tympanic membrane piece connection shaft, the outer side of the outermost side medium box is provided with a supporting plate, the length of a separation unit is the distance between one supporting plate to one adjacent tympanic membrane piece. The pulsating high gradient superconducting magnetic separation machine can continuously feed one supporting mechanism in front of the motion, and flush, in a site, one adjacent supporting mechanism in the back of the motion, and has the advantages of continuous production and high capacity.

Description

technical field [0001] The invention relates to a production equipment for realizing separation according to the magnetic difference of materials, in particular to a pulsating high-gradient superconducting magnetic separator. Background technique [0002] Chinese patent application for a reciprocating pulsating high-gradient magnetic separation system with a solenoid-type superconducting magnet, application number 201310516009.3, for configuring a pulsating system on the reciprocating superconducting high-gradient magnetic separation system, and setting a pulp inlet and outlet channel that matches the pulsating system , so that the pulp in the magnetic separation link and the flushing water in the washing link can realize pulsation. The reciprocating system is equipped with two independent pulsation systems, which can operate independently in the magnetic separation and washing links.
